[Well after that gigantic mess people would find a large plant beast dragging itself into the Hangar at Sakihama before finding an empty spot to lie down like an oversized, lazy and rather ugly dog. It smelled slightly of burnt plant when one got too close to it. There was a slight shuffling noise before its torso opened and disgorged a stumbling Volya - who was kept from falling when a few vines caught him by the mid-section and righted him.]
Ack!
[The vines retracted slowly as the beast's torso closed up once more like a flower blooming in reverse as a low noise rumbled out from it.]
-Geez... I.. I'm fine. Really... just a little dizzy. You're going to be okay here... right?-
[Another rumbling as its head perks up and tilts slightly.]
-No I don't need anything... you just get some rest you big goof.-
[Volya rolls his eyes before he places a hand on the beast's head. He sighs tiredly before noticing you were there and letting out a yelp and falling over, babbling in russian before finally managing to remember to speak something else.]
A..ah... sorry... didn't see you there...
[2]
[With Volya now a resident at Sakihama base it was time for him to get acclimated. And by that I mean stuff his face. He's got a lot of food with him and if what some people had seen back at the food lines was any indicator, the kid was really hungry and wasn't at all picky about what he ate and he looked like he wasn't going to stop anytime soon, of course he freezes and sets down his spoon a little anxiously when he notices your look.]
Is it really okay for me to eat this much?
[Sure Willis said so, but Volya wanted to be careful not to annoy anyone and... another thought occurs to him.]
And... er... I'm... not going to have to go to school here am I? I... can't read Japanese...
[3]
[And with all the above said and done, Volya finally finds his way to his room. A bed. With blankets. And a place with running, heated water. Again. He's been without these for months and its right now that he realized just how much he missed these apparently simple things as he literally makes a dash and dives onto his bed, bouncing up once with a short, happy laugh before just burying himself in it. Then it just turns into a soft and discomforted sigh.]
...
[They were probably going to make him fight. And then the knights were still after him. And David. And his Uncle Sergei...]
-mh...said it before and I'll say it again... I'd pass over adventure for a quiet day.-
